Advertising, Public Relations, and Marketing
The core of advertising, public relations, and marketing lies in the ability to use media communication strategies to precisely target the audience, enhancing brand value and market influence. With the rapid development of digital technology and big data, modern advertising and public relations are no longer limited to traditional media. Instead, they integrate Artificial Intelligence (AI), behavioral data analysis, and precision marketing techniques to create personalized and efficient brand communication models. This program covers topics such as advertising production and creative strategies, digital public relations, brand management, social media marketing, and big data analysis. It aims to cultivate students' ability to grasp market trends, use data-driven decision-making, perform audience segmentation, and optimize content to maximize the effectiveness of precision marketing. Whether for government agencies, businesses, or non-profit organizations, managing media presence, promoting ideas and products, and mastering advertising, public relations, and precision marketing expertise have become essential skills in the modern communication field.
Establishment Background
This program is based on the "Marketing Communication Program," designed to cultivate cross-disciplinary talent with expertise in advertising, public relations, and marketing communication. With the rapid advancement of digital technologies, especially the application of big data analysis, AI, and precision marketing techniques, marketing communication models are continuously innovating, and industry demand is increasing. Therefore, our curriculum provides a solid foundation in advertising, public relations, and marketing theory while integrating the latest digital technologies, including social media marketing, content marketing, brand data analysis, AI-driven consumer insights, and marketing automation. This helps students stay ahead of market trends, optimize marketing strategies using technology, improve competitiveness, and prepare for future career challenges.
Teaching Features
The program's professional courses combine creative thinking with data analysis to help students develop problem-solving skills and strengthen marketing planning, writing, and external communication abilities. Courses cover areas such as advertising planning and strategy, public relations planning, social media marketing, big data analysis and applications, AI-driven marketing decision-making, content marketing, and brand management, enabling students to master integrated strategies for both traditional and digital marketing.To enhance students' practical skills, the program incorporates industry-based courses. Through data-driven social media marketing projects, students participate in hands-on activities such as brand management, advertising placement, and influencer marketing strategy planning. Additionally, students can engage with the department's fan page, "My FoDa Media Era," for data analysis and marketing optimization. They are also encouraged to participate in competitions such as the Golden Tripod Awards, National Public Relations Planning Contest, Digital Marketing Contest, and Short Video Creation Competitions, boosting their industry competitiveness and laying a solid foundation for future career development.
